A leading consultancy in Greater London is seeking a regulatory assurance manager. You will lead engagements, advise clients on compliance and risk management, and develop long-term relationships.
The ideal candidate has experience in compliance or regulatory roles, strong analytical skills, and a degree-level education. Advanced skills in PowerPoint, Word, and Excel are essential.
This role offers competitive remuneration and opportunities for professional growth.
